Wireless sensor networks (WSNs) contains a lot of very small sensor nodes measuring the environmental conditions in which they are spread. The task of sensors is to collect data, to convert them into an electronic signal, and to transmit signal for being processed in the base station via reliable wireless communication media. One of the challenges of these networks is limitation in energy sources that small batteries with low energy feed sensors. Clustering is one of the ways to reduce energy consumption, so that nodes classified in clusters, in each one, a node is selected as a cluster head. The cluster head is responsible for exchanging information with the base station, and other nodes use the head as an interface to communicate with the base station, and all information of each cluster is transmitted to the base station by the cluster head. In this paper, LEACH protocol using artificial intelligence is suggested to improve the energy efficiency of these networks. To achieve this goal, the proposed five-factor method includes the energy level of node, the number of neighbors, centrality, the distance of node with the base station, and the number of rounds that the node has not been cluster head have been applied in the fuzzy logic frame to select the cluster head. Selecting these factors and a node having these parameters as the cluster head, it improves the energy in the network, and it increases the network lifetime. The simulation results of the proposed method using 2-NS simulator shows the good performance of the proposed method as FLECH in the criteria of network lifetime and the number of alive nodes until the end of network lifetime.
